London is considering a tourist tax. Here’s what it could mean for visitors

London's mayor Sadiq Khan supports a potential tourist tax to help fund local infrastructure, similar to taxes in other European cities like Barcelona and Paris. While these taxes can generate significant revenue for cities, there are concerns about their impact on tourism and the hospitality sector. Critics argue that rising fees could deter visitors, especially budget-conscious travelers. The ongoing debate highlights the complexities of managing tourism and its effects on local communities.
